German philosopher and social critic Jürgen Habermas dies at 96
One the most influential thinkers in post-war Germany, he linked philosophy and political action throughout his life.

Jürgen Habermas, renowned for his work on communication, rationality, and modern society, passed away at 96 in Starnberg, near Munich. His seminal work, 'The Theory of Communicative Action,' remains central to understanding his vision of social interaction.
Jürgen Habermas, considered the moral conscience of contemporary Germany and a key figure in the Frankfurt School, died at 96 in Starnberg, Bavaria. His works, including 'The Theory of Communicative Action,' have profoundly influenced European thought.
Jürgen Habermas, the German philosopher and sociologist known for works like 'History and Critique of the Public Sphere' and 'The Theory of Communicative Action,' passed away at 96 in Starnberg. He was a prominent figure in the Frankfurt School's Critical Theory.
